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Get Replies

Feeling unsure what to say is normal — the good news is that a few reliable patterns make starting conversations easier. Use these adaptable opener types and short examples to spark natural replies without sounding rehearsed.

Profile-based hooks

Pick one small, specific detail from their profile and ask about it. This shows you read their profile and gives them an easy way to respond.

  • Observation + question: "I see you like weekend hikes — what trail made you fall in love with hiking?"
  • Curious compare: "You listed coffee and board games. Which would you pick for a lazy Sunday and why?"

Low-pressure personal questions

Keep the tone light and specific so it doesn’t feel like an interview or an intense reveal.

  • "What’s one small thing that always improves your day?"
  • "If you could learn any skill this year, what would you try first?"

Fun, adaptable opener patterns

Swap in details to make these feel personal rather than copy-paste.

  • Two-choice prompt: "Which would you choose: beach sunrise or city rooftop sunset?"
  • Finish-the-sentence: "The best playlist for a road trip always includes..."
  • Playful hypothesis: "I bet you have a weirdly strong opinion about pineapple on pizza. True or false?"

Light callbacks and follow-ups

When someone mentions something in their profile or a previous message, reference it briefly to show attention and keep the conversation moving.

  • "You mentioned learning Portuguese — how’s that going this month?"
  • "You said you love spicy food. Any hot sauce recommendations for a beginner?"

What to avoid

Small adjustments can make a big difference.

  • Avoid one-word openers like "Hey" or generic compliments that could apply to anyone. They give nothing to reply to.
  • Skip overly intense personal questions on first contact (e.g., past relationships, finances). Save depth for later.
  • Don’t pretend to know them — curious questions beat forced familiarity.

Quick checklist before you hit send

  1. Is it specific to their profile or easily answerable? If not, tweak it.
  2. Would you respond to this message? If the answer is no, make it more interesting or smaller in scope.
  3. Keep it short and leave room for them to ask a question back.
